Job Description

Joining TUI Airways as part of the Customer Delivery leadership team you will be directly accountable for the management and leadership of Gatwick base, you will lead a team of experts including a large remote Cabin Crew community to ensure that TUI Airways delivers industry leading standards for on board customer experience, inflight revenue sales and colleague engagement.


Flexibility will be required to undertake the shift-based nature of this role with a commitment to on-call responsibilities. Due to the highly operational nature, the role will be based onsite at Gatwick with very limited opportunity to work remotely.
